Ingredients
- 1 (13-15 oz) bag sturdy tortilla chips
- 1 lb ground beef or shredded chicken, cooked and seasoned (or 2 cans black beans, rinsed and drained, for vegetarian)
- 2 cups shredded Monterey Jack cheese
- 1 cup shredded sharp C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up diced red onion
- 1/2 cup sliced pickled jalapeños (or fresh, if preferred)
- 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
- Optional: 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ro, for garnish
- Optional: Sour cream, guacamole, salsa, for serving
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Generously spray a 10-12 cup Bundt pan with non-stick cooking spray.
- Arrange a single layer of tortilla chips in the bottom of the Bundt pan, breaking some to fit.
- Sprinkle with a layer of mixed cheeses, then some cooked protein (or beans), red onion, jalapeños, and tomatoes.
- Repeat the layering process, gently pressing down each layer, until the pan is full, ending with a generous layer of cheese on top.
- Place the Bundt pan on a baking sheet and bake for 15-20 minutes, or until cheese is bubbly and melted, and chips are golden.
- Remove from oven and let cool for 2-3 minutes. Place a large serving platter over the Bundt pan and carefully invert.
- Garnish with fresh cilantro and serve immediately with sour cream, guacamole, and salsa in the center well.
- Prep Time: 15 mins
- Cook Time: 20 mins
